Understanding the Basics of Screen Protectors

Before diving into the myths and facts, let’s first understand what screen protectors are and their primary functions. Screen protectors are thin layers of material that are applied to the surface of a screen to safeguard against scratches, smudges, and other damages. They are commonly used for smartphones, tablets, and laptops to enhance their longevity.

The Types of Screen Protectors

There are generally two major types of screen protectors available in the market:

  • Tempered Glass Protectors: They are made from heated and treated glass, resulting in high durability and excellent scratch resistance.
  • Plastic Film Protectors: These are softer and more flexible than glass options. While they tend to be cheaper, they offer less protection than tempered glass.

Myth 2: All Screen Protectors Are the Same

Another common misconception is that all screen protectors provide the same level of protection. This myth can lead consumers to choose cheaper options that may not provide adequate defense against impact and scratches.

The Fact: Quality Matters

The quality of screen protectors varies significantly among brands and types. High-quality tempered glass offers superior protection compared to lower-end plastic options. When selecting a screen protector, you should consider factors such as:

  • Durability and scratch resistance
  • Clarity and touch sensitivity
  • Ease of installation

Myth 3: Screen Protectors Make Screens Less Responsive

Some users avoid using screen protectors due to the belief that they will hinder touch screen responsiveness. This concern is primarily based on past experiences with thicker plastic films.

The Fact: Modern Screen Protectors Are Designed for Sensitivity

Today’s high-quality screen protectors are designed to maintain optimal touch sensitivity. Particularly, tempered glass protectors provide a smooth texture that feels like the original screen. Concerns about response time are largely a relic of older, thicker films.

Myth 4: Screen Protectors Are Difficult to Install

Many people shy away from screen protectors due to the belief that they are tough to install. The thought of air bubbles and misalignment can be intimidating.

The Fact: Installation Has Come a Long Way

While installation used to be a challenge, today’s screen protectors often come with easy installation kits. Many brands offer bubble-free installation processes that ensure a smooth application. With clear instructions and tools provided, you can achieve a professional finish without hassle.

Myth 6: Anti-Glare Screen Protectors Are Not Worth It

Some users dismiss anti-glare screen protectors on the premise that they impair screen visibility. This myth might lead consumers to avoid investing in these types of protectors.

The Fact: Anti-Glare Protectors Can Enhance Visibility

While it is true that some anti-glare protectors may reduce color vibrancy, many modern options are designed to enhance visibility in bright surroundings. If you frequently use your device outdoors or in high-light situations, an anti-glare option can significantly improve your viewing experience.

Myth 10: Screen Protectors Can’t Be Removed

Some people are led to believe that once a screen protector is applied, it cannot be removed without damaging the screen. This myth can make users hesitant to install one in the first place.

The Fact: Many Are Easily Removable

Most screen protectors are designed for easy removal without causing damage. If you need to replace an old protector with a new one, you can usually peel it off without any issues. Follow the manufacturer's instructions for the best results.
